What is included in the fixed price?
The whole property, cleaned empty of personal belongings, against a written checklist you get before we start. Furnished lets are fine and the price doesn't change. Inside every cupboard, inside the oven, full descaling, then joinery, glass and floors. The checklist is the contract, which is what makes the guarantee mean anything.
Kitchen
Oven inside, hob, extractor filter, cupboards emptied and wiped inside and out, sink and taps descaled, floor washed to the edges.
Bathrooms
Screen, tiles and grout descaled, bath, basin, toilet inside and behind, extractor vent dusted, chrome polished.
Bedrooms and living rooms
Wardrobes and drawers inside, shelves, skirting, radiators, light fittings, and marks off paintwork where they lift safely.
Windows and glass
Inside glass, frames, sills and the tracks that inventory clerks always run a finger along. All of it is inside the fixed price, with no windows add-on on a move-out clean.
Floors
Carpets vacuumed throughout, hard floors washed, edges and corners done by hand.
Touch points
Doors, frames, handles, switches, sockets, bannisters, bin cleaned and relined, cobwebs off corners.
Can my landlord charge me for cleaning when I move out?
Not in advance, and not by naming a cleaner. Under the Tenant Fees Act 2019 a landlord or agent cannot require you to pay for professional end of tenancy cleaning, and cannot require you to use a particular cleaner. They can deduct from the deposit at the end if the property is returned dirtier than at check-in, minus fair wear and tear.
Nobody has to book us, so here's the honest case
Cleaning is still the most common cause of deposit deductions, and over half of deposit disputes involve cleaning. That's the real reason people buy a clean the law says they don't need. The argument at check-out is almost never about effort. It's about whether the standard matches the check-in record, judged by someone who inspects properties for a living.
If your inventory was light and the flat is small, clean it yourself and keep the £130. If a deduction would cost you more than the clean, a fixed price and a checklist you can forward is the cheaper risk. The rules are set out properly in our guide on whether landlords can charge for cleaning.

Why is hard water the real Dartford problem?
North Kent sits on chalk and the local water is hard. Hard water leaves limescale on taps, shower screens and inside kettles and ovens, and it does that whether the property is a new flat or a converted terrace. Check-out inspections in this part of Kent focus on it.
The reason it costs tenants money is that scale doesn't look like dirt. A clerk sees a cloudy screen and a white ring at the base of the tap and writes down that the bathroom wasn't cleaned, which isn't quite what happened. Removing it properly wants the right acid, real dwell time and a second pass. That's a named block on our checklist with its own time on the job, and it's most of what you're actually buying. What does the 48-hour re-clean guarantee not cover?
Four things, published beside the promise: pre-existing damage, permanent staining, mould, and areas we couldn't get to on the day. If a worktop was already chipped or a carpet already burnt, a second visit changes nothing and we'll tell you that before you book.
Everything else on the agreed checklist is covered. Tell us within 48 hours and we'll come back and re-clean the affected areas free.
